Dutch FTTH coverage up 10% in 2019, new record in homes passed expected in 2020

2020-05-04 08:41: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) The Netherlands added 287,000 new homes passed with FTTH in 2019, taking the total to 3.20 million. The 10 percent growth in the number of homes passed takes the country to around 40 percent of households with access to fibre, according to the Telecompaper annual report FTTH in the Netherlands 2020. The market is expected to grow at an even faster pace in 2020.
